Flor Bex


Florent (Flor) Bex, Master of History of Art and Archaeology (RUG, 1963), was director of the International Cultural Centre in Antwerp (ICC), founder of Artefactum (international magazine on contemporary art), director of the Museum of Contemporary Art Antwerp (M HKA), director of Bex Art Consult bvba and Art Consultant for Aon Belgium NV. He has organised more than 600 exhibitions of contemporary art in Belgium and abroad, edited catalogues for these exhibitions, published numerous articles in catalogues, books and magazines, was a professor and visiting professor at various universities in Belgium and abroad and Honorary President of the Association of Belgian Art Critics (AICA). Although our country is drifting further and further apart politically, the Belgian identity survives in the visual arts', is Flor Bex's conclusion. The book "Art in Belgium after 1975'' is a farewell, because in February 2002 Bex resigned as curator of the M HKA. In 2017, M-Museum Leuven and the Province of Flemish Brabant organised OPEN M for the fourth time with Flor Bex as guest curator.
